Top attractions in Nicaragua

Nicaragua's attractions showcase everything from natural wonders to cultural treasures, making it ideal for adventurers and history enthusiasts alike. Whether you're seeking volcanic peaks, tropical islands, or colonial charm, this diverse country delivers unforgettable experiences at every turn.

  • Granada — A beautifully preserved colonial city with colourful architecture, local markets, and charming streets perfect for exploring on foot.
  • Lake Nicaragua (Lago Cocibolca) — The largest freshwater lake in Central America, home to the Islets of Granada and opportunities for kayaking and wildlife spotting.
  • Ometepe Island — A stunning island formed by two volcanic peaks, offering hiking trails, hot springs, and stunning lake views.
  • San Juan del Sur — A lively Pacific coastal town with excellent beaches, surfing, nightlife, and a laid-back traveller vibe.
  • Corn Islands — Remote Caribbean islands with pristine beaches, coral reefs, and a slower pace perfect for diving and relaxation.

Popular foods to try in Nicaragua

Nicaraguan cuisine blends indigenous, Spanish, and Caribbean influences, creating hearty and flavourful dishes centred around fresh seafood, beans, rice, and tropical fruits. The food reflects the country's agricultural abundance and coastal access, with recipes passed down through generations. Don't miss the chance to taste authentic regional specialties that showcase the warmth and generosity of Nicaraguan culture.

  • Gallo Pinto — A beloved breakfast dish of rice and beans seasoned with peppers and onions, often served with fresh fruit and fried cheese.
  • Vigoron — A popular street food combining yuca (cassava root), cabbage slaw, and a spicy tomato sauce.
  • Nacatadas — Fried beef chunks typically served with rice, beans, and plantains for a satisfying main course.
  • Ceviche — Fresh raw seafood cured in citrus juice, a coastal specialty particularly popular in Caribbean communities.
  • Rondon — A creamy Caribbean stew made with seafood, coconut milk, and root vegetables reflecting the Atlantic coast's flavours.

Best time to visit Nicaragua

The dry season from November to April is the ideal time to visit Nicaragua, offering sunny days, lower humidity, and perfect conditions for beach activities and hiking. During these months, accommodation and tour operators are in full operation, and you'll encounter the most favourable weather across the country's diverse regions.

The rainy season from May to October brings lush landscapes and fewer tourists, though afternoon showers are common and some rural roads may become difficult to navigate. If you're budget-conscious and don't mind occasional rain, the green season offers lower prices and a more authentic experience with vibrant flora and excellent wildlife viewing opportunities.

What to pack for your visit to Nicaragua

Nicaragua's tropical climate and varied terrain require thoughtful packing to ensure comfort during both beach days and jungle adventures. Prepare for heat, humidity, rain, and the occasional cooler mountain temperatures in the highlands.

  • Lightweight, breathable clothing — Cotton and moisture-wicking fabrics are essential for navigating hot, humid lowlands and keeping cool.
  • Rain jacket or poncho — Afternoon showers are common during the rainy season, and sudden downpours can occur year-round in coastal areas.
  • Sturdy hiking boots or trail shoes — Essential for volcano hikes, jungle trails, and exploring uneven colonial streets in Granada and other towns.
  • High SPF sunscreen and insect repellent — The tropical sun is intense and mosquitoes thrive in humid areas, particularly near water and in evening hours.
  • Water shoes or sandals for water activities — Perfect for beach days, kayaking on Lake Nicaragua, and swimming in cenotes or island coves.
